If You Have a Website, Keep the Bounce Rate Low

Comments Off on If You Have a Website, Keep the Bounce Rate Low

Bounce Rate implies the percentage of your website visitors who leave a page immediately after landing on it. They land on your website but leave for another site without viewing the content of your site.
